Paresh Paluskar is the Director of Process and Analytical Development at STEMCELL Technologies, where he leads a team of over 95 members. His group focuses on new product introduction, process scale-up, and developing future manufacturing automation. He earned his PhD from the Eindhoven University of Technology and has a background in material sciences and biologics.
Pareshs interests are rooted in applying deep science to industrial challenges. His career spans from managing the development of large-scale solar PV power plants to inventing novel silica composites for commercial applications. His academic work was in the highly specialized field of spin-polarized tunneling, reflecting a passion for fundamental physics and its applications.
He is an inventor on multiple patents for material science, including a method for creating high surface area precipitated silica.
